Many large national retail chains participate in triple net lease agreements in order to avoid making large capital investments. These companies prefer to keep funds liquid for other investments. A triple net lease is attractive to many real estate investors and developers. One reason is the sharing of financial responsibility another is the passivity of the investment. Once the initial capital is invested, owners can reap the benefits of rental fees and the lack of maintenance fees, while still having the ability to use the tax benefits that come with ownership.
